Transaction 95fda6db2c26e27e6ecc3cb5ce28f5332542bc400748f7cf2836755208a800cf
1 Input
1 Output
-
95fda6db2c26e27e6ecc3cb5ce28f5332542bc400748f7cf2836755208a800cf:0
- value
- 89110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9b89893de89d978e28cac4cff5f287c4b9b1891 OP_EQUAL
- address
- 3Jd24zF4Fy86PcauULjzuer8xKdRMQ6sHt